Everyone at Fulham was deeply saddened to learn of the passing of our colleague and friend Zara Harrison (née Barka) on Thursday this week.

Zara worked in the Club’s commercial department as Head of Experience & Venue Events, and was a major contributing factor behind the many off-the-field successes Fulham has enjoyed over the years.

These included the organisation and event management of many high profile international fixtures at Craven Cottage, in addition to her day-to-day responsibilities in supporting the Club.

Zara worked for the Whites since February 2005, and took great joy in watching from the stands at Wembley last May as the Club won promotion back to the Premier League.

A very popular figure around Craven Cottage and the training ground, Zara was known for her fantastic work ethic, dedication, sense of humour and wit, and will be missed dearly by everyone who knew her.

Our thoughts are now with her husband Mark and young son Oska, and the rest of Zara’s family and friends, at this very sad time.
